ORDER FOR JUDGMENT

 

UPON APPLICATION by the appellants to introduce fresh evidence and for leave to appeal the decisions of Justice Scott Norton dated July 2, 2024 (2024 NSSC 183 and 2024 NSSC 184), and, if successful to appeal those decisions;

AND UPON hearing Donn Fraser, the appellant on his behalf and on behalf of the company, DLP Law Practice Incorporated, and Bruce MacIntosh, the respondent on his own behalf;

AND UPON the Court delivering its unanimous decision at the conclusion of oral argument denying the motion to adduce fresh evidence, denying leave to appeal and dismissing the appeal;

I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that the motion to adduce fresh evidence is dismissed, leave to appeal is denied and the appeal is dismissed with costs of $3,000, to the respondent payable forthwith and in any event of the cause.
